Additionally, a prompt asking for a summary of each paper did not correspond to the original publications [2, 4, 5] and contained incorrect information about the study period and the participants.Even more disturbing, the command "regenerate response" leads to different results and conclusions [].So the question arises whether artificial …Correct — that is why I often refer to hallucinations like DevOps people refer to “uptime”. For some people, 98% is good enough — for others, they need 99.999% accuracy. Hallucination is like “uptime” or “security”. There is no 100%. Over time, we will come to expect “Five 9s” with hallucinations too.May 2, 2024 ... However, there have been instances where advanced AI systems, such as generative models, have been found to produce hallucinations, particularly when …An AI hallucination is when a generative AI model generates inaccurate information but presents it as if it were true. AI hallucinations are caused by limitations and/or biases in training data and algorithms, which can potentially result in producing content that is not just wrong but harmful. It is in our homes in the form of Siri, Alexa and ...Artificial hallucination is uncommon in chatbots since they respond based on preprogrammed rules and data sets. However, in the case of advanced AI systems where new information is generated, artificial hallucination might emerge as a serious concern, especially when trained using large amounts of unsupervised data 5.
